The Role We are looking to engage with Freelance Teaching Assistant Tutors, provisionally for 3-6 months, to hold cohorts in Lincoln, Gainsborough and Boston. Please note: We are currently only recruiting for qualified trainers. If you do not have the required qualifications, we will be unable to take you further at this stage. You must have all required certificates and CPD up to date. As a Teaching Assistant Tutor at Realise, you will play a key role in supporting adult learners to achieve recognised qualifications (Award in Support Work in Schools and Colleges and Award in Preparing to Work in Schools RQF) and build the skills they need for life and work. Working closely with Tutors and the wider team, you will help deliver high-quality, inclusive provision while providing tailored support to individuals throughout their learning journey. Your encouragement, organisation and commitment will help learners overcome barriers and progress with confidence. Whilst no two days will be the same, your responsibilities are likely to include: - Supporting the delivery of educational qualifications in hubs, community venues and online, ensuring learning is accessible, engaging and tailored to individual needs. - Managing a caseload of learners, identifying and addressing barriers to achievement and providing ongoing support to keep them on track. - Assisting with planning, delivery and assessment activities, including monitoring attendance, conducting assessments, providing constructive feedback, completing marking and invigilating exams where required. - Completing post-enrolment administration, ensuring compliance, accurate documentation and timely submission of paperwork using e-portfolio systems. - Working collaboratively with learner recruitment and quality assurance teams to share best practice, contribute to curriculum improvements and drive high achievement rates. - Creating and maintaining a positive, inclusive and respectful learning environment. - Embedding Safeguarding and British Values within sessions and supporting learners’ personal development. NB. Our cohorts are typically delivered across 16 consecutive weekdays. Delivery is between 9.30am-3.30pm with the remaining 2 hours saved for marking. ​ Where will I be based? This is a hub-based role, with your time split between Lincoln, Boston and Gainsborough. This will be discussed with you further in your interview. ​ What Happens Next? - The Realise Recruitment team will be in touch, regardless of the outcome. - Our interview process is tailored to each role and can be in-person or held remotely. - You can expect a two-stage interview process for this position, which will compromise of a short telephone screen call, followed by a one-hour formal interview, either in person or on Teams, where we will ask you a series of competency and behavioural questions, followed by a short microteach. - As an inclusive employer please do let us know if you require any reasonable adjustments. About You - Teaching experience with knowledge of SEND, Autism and/or Forest Schools. - Recent frontline operational experience relevant to the qualifications delivered. - Minimum Level 3 teaching qualification (AET, PTLLS) and assessing qualification (CAVA, TAQA, A1, D32, D33). - Occupational competency in subject(s) taught, and commitment to maintaining this. - UK driving licence, own vehicle, and willingness to travel as needed. ​ About Us - Realise helps more than 18,000 learners every year to achieve their goals.
